How do you get your gaunlets to fit your rist?

I just recently recieved some RA gaunlets. but they are realy lose around my rists, the only way i can think of makin them fit better is to stuff socks in them. Id love to know how some of you THD members did it. Thanks inadvance. Much apreiciation.

I used pieces of foam I bought at WalMart and hot glued them to the inside of my gauntlets. Since I have small arms and my gauntlets were quite big, I had to use a lot. Fit great and you can't even tell there is foam inside!
 
I use self-adhesive weather stripping. You can find it at Home Depot. It's a roll of foam that's roughly an inch around on each side and has a self-adhesive back. Just cut small lengths of it and place it where you need it.

Works great for gauntlets :)

To anyone else interested, it can also be used to pad a helmet, or to make Stormtrooper armor fit more closely (in the arm pieces. It also can be used to reduce pieces rubbing against each other, chipping paint or gloss-finishes, and helps cut down on that clacking noise from the pieces hitting each other.

I also have a pair of highly modified RA gauntlets & I used spray contact cement to adhere a thin piece of foam to the lower half of the gauntlet shells. No problem with slippage at all!
